National Census of Ferry Operators (NCFO)

On a biennial basis, the Bureau of Transportation Statistics (BTS) conducts a census of all ferry operators operating in the United States and its territories.  The information collected from the census is maintained in a national ferry database containing information regarding ferry routes, vessels, passengers and vehicles carried, funding sources and other information.  BTS conducted the initial NCFO in 2006 and has subsequently conducted the NCFO in 2008, 2010, 2014, and 2016. The data collection for the next NCFO will begin in the Spring of 2018.

Industry Snapshots

Industry Snapshots, developed by the Bureau of Transportation Statistics, uses information from the Transportation Satellite Accounts (TSAs) and other sources to highlight the role of for-hire and business-related in-house transportation in the production process for all of the non-transportation sectors listed in the U.S. Input Output (I-O) accounts.

State Transportation Statistics

How does your state's transportation profile look? The State Transportation Statistics (STS) present data on each state's infrastructure, safety, freight movement, passenger travel, vehicles, economy and finance, and energy and the environment. Transportation Statistics Annual Report

The Transportation Statistics Annual Report (TSAR) describes the Nation’s transportation system, the system’s performance, its contributions to the economy, and its effects on people and the environment. This report is based on information collected or compiled by the Bureau of Transportation Statistics (BTS), a principle Federal statistical agency at the U.S. Department of Transportation.
